Formal Refinement for Operating System Kernels
Author: Iain D. Craig
Publisher: Springer Science & Business Media
Published: 2007-07-18
Total Pages: 343
ISBN-13: 184628967X
DOWNLOAD EBOOKThe kernel of any operating system is its most critical component, as the rest of the system depends on it. This book shows how the formal specification of kernels can be followed by a completely formal refinement process that leads to the extraction of executable code. This formal refinement process ensures that the code precisely meets the specification. The author documents the complete process, including proofs.